Robert Lee Riffle, Sr., 81, of Mooresville passed away on Sunday, May 9, 2021 at his residence.

He was born January 22, 1940 in Columbus, OH to the late Harvey Everett Riffle and Genevieve Buckalew Riffle. Robert was a member of Williamson‘s Chapel United Methodist Church in Mooresville and retired from the auto racing industry. He enjoyed gardening and racing, and loved his wife, children and grandchildren.

A celebration of life to celebrate Robert‘s life will be held at a later date.

Bob was the Head Engine Builder at Petty Enterprises from 1991-1994.  He also was an engine builder at Roush Racing for Mark Martin and Ted Musgrave, and also built engines at Pro Motor, including Ricky Rudd‘s 1997 Brickyard 400 engine.

Prior to NASCAR, he was a drag racer, both as a driver and engine builder.  He was a 2 time winner of the US Nationals and built Pro Stock engines.
